Right, I've changed my lantus to 10pm not 8am on the advise of my consultant... it worked for a day and a half but now back to square one so I did a basal test this morning, hope I did it right:
8am BM 8.3
10am BM 8.7 (ate a boiled egg and a bit of gruyere cheese as I was starving)
12 noon BM 12.7!
So, I am going to test another 2 days this week and then go onto lunch time fasting etc... but do you think that so far it seems like my basal is running out at lunch time? This would make sense as the last few days since changing lantus times (apart from today typically!) I have been 5s until lunchtime and then it rockets to anywhere between 11 and 15 in the afternoon/evening!
I am assuming eggs and cheese were ok to eat as no carbs?
If I increase my basal does it mean that it will last longer or that I will be getting more of it before lunchtime if not lasting long enough at the mo? Apart from today my waking sugars have been 5 which is perfect so don't want to suddenly get hypos if I increase
